About Accounting & Auditing Law in Kingston, Jamaica:

Accounting & Auditing law in Kingston, Jamaica encompasses regulations and guidelines that govern the financial reporting and auditing practices of businesses and organizations in the country. These laws are designed to ensure transparency, accuracy, and accountability in financial reporting.

Local Laws Overview:

The Companies Act, Income Tax Act, and Financial Services Commission Act are some of the key laws that are particularly relevant to Accounting & Auditing in Kingston, Jamaica. These laws outline the requirements for financial reporting, auditing standards, tax obligations, and regulatory compliance for businesses operating in the country.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What are the requirements for financial reporting in Jamaica?

In Jamaica, businesses are required to prepare annual financial statements in accordance with the International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S) or the Jamaican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P).

2. What is the role of an auditor in Jamaica?

An auditor in Jamaica is responsible for examining the financial statements of a company to ensure they are accurate and comply with relevant laws and regulations.

5. Are there any regulations for setting up accounting systems in Jamaica?

Yes, businesses in Jamaica are required to maintain proper accounting records and implement internal controls to prevent fraud and errors in financial reporting.
